Outokumpu

Environmental targets

Outokumpu sets environmental targets both group-wide and at site level. Group-wide targets are common targets that affects to most of the sites. At production sites targets are more specific.

The Group’s key environmental targets are to prevent soil contamination, to reduce emissions into water and air, to improve energy efficiency and to optimize the use of water. The enhanced use of recycled steel as raw material and the reduction of process waste are also important targets.

Here are individual targets for production sites in 2008.

Air Protection
• Tornio
Increase usage of dust reduction units to
more than 98% per month.

• Newcastle
Add a new scrubber to one of the
production lines.

• Avesta
To decrease the carbon dioxide emissions by 2 percent to 375 kg/ton.

Use of Materials
• Kemi mine
Reuse 200 000 tons of lumpy rock from the
concentrating plant to backfill stopes in the
underground mine.

• Sheffield, melting shop
Reduce consumption of hydraulic oil by
10% (with 2007 as the reference year)
through a program of leakage reduction
measures.
Maintain the on-site recycling for primary
dusts to match dust output from the
melting shop.

• Tornio
Produce more than 120 000 tons of steel
slag products.

Energy Efficiency
• Avesta
Reduce electricity consumption by 3%
from 980 to 950 kWh per ton.
Reduce consumption of liquid petroleum
gas (LPG) by 3% from 66 to 64 kg per ton.


• Sheffield, melting shop
Reduce specific energy consumption by 2%.


• Nyby, tube mill
Reduce total energy consumption by 2%.

Waste Management
• Tornio
Reduce quantity of landfill waste by
10% per final product ton.


• Sheffield melting shop
Increase the quantity of waste being
recycled so that the amount of waste sent
to landfill is reduced by 10%.


• Sheffield rod mill
Reduce the quantity of general waste being
sent to landfill by 10% by identifying
additional opportunities to reduce, reuse or
recycle material that is currently being
disposed of in this way.


• Örnsköldsvik tube mill
Reduce deposited material by 10%.

 

Water Protection
• Avesta
Reduce nitrate discharges to water by 10%
and achieve 1kg/ton as a monthly average.

• Sheffield melting shop
Reduce specific water consumption by 5%
with 2007 as the reference year.


• Degerfors
Increase water filter capacity in the hot
rolling mill to minimize the risk of
accidental discharges.

Soil protection
• Sheffield melting shop
Improve ground protection by installing
storage tanks and bunds for grinder cellar
water.

Management systems
• Group

The process of integrating management
systems that comply with the EN-14001,
EN-9001 and BS-18001 standards and
relevant energy management systems into a
single environment, health and safety
quality system has been initiated. The target
is for at least one business unit to be ready
for implementation by the end of 2008.

Group wide environmental targets for corporate responsibility theme year 2008
• To reduce waste: landfill from plant
operations by 10 percent per ton
processed, and non-classified (e.g.
plastic cups and other non-recyclable
material) from offices by 5 percent
• To reduce energy consumption: at plants
by 2 percent per ton processed, and in
offices by 5 percent (e.g. using energy
saving lamps, turning off lights and
computers when not in use, not leaving
in stand-by position)
• To contribute to reducing global carbon
dioxide (CO2) emissions
- New company cars to be low emission
cars (below 200g CO2 /km);
company car policy to be revised
- Outokumpu promotes tele/videoconferences
vs. flying; travel policy to
be revised
- Outokumpu invests 5 million euros in
an environmental target to be identified through a group wide competition
